How much does a Stocker make in Moscow, ID?

The average salary for a Stocker is $32,009 per year in Moscow, ID.

In Moscow, Idaho, the average yearly salary for a stocker is around $32,000. This role plays a key part in keeping shelves stocked and well-organized in retail and warehouse settings. For those interested in this position, understanding the salary can help in budgeting and setting career goals.


Stockers can expect to earn between $29,000 and $36,500 per year. The distribution of salaries shows that most stockers fall around the middle of this range. Here’s a quick look at the salary breakdown:

  • 8.80% earn between $29,000 and $30,000
  • 5.28% earn between $30,000 and $31,000
  • 19.35% earn between $31,000 and $32,000
  • 29.91% earn between $32,000 and $33,000
  • 8.80% earn between $33,000 and $34,000
  • 12.31% earn between $34,000 and $35,000
  • 1.76% earn between $35,000 and $36,500
This data helps potential job seekers know what to expect in terms of earnings in this role.
